Job Summary

The Administrative Assistant II provides advanced administrative support to department leaders and teams within the facility. This role performs complex clerical and organizational tasks manages calendars prepares reports coordinates meetings and ensures effective communication across departments. The Administrative Assistant II acts as a liaison between leaders and stakeholders maintains records and handles confidential information with professionalism and discretion.

Essential Functions

  • Prepares complex correspondence presentations and reports with a high degree of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Manages multiple calendars schedules meetings and appointments and prepares agendas for departmental leaders.
  • Coordinates and facilitates meetings including arranging logistics taking minutes and ensuring follow-up on action items.
  • Maintains and organizes electronic and physical filing systems for department documents records and reports.
  • Acts as a point of contact for internal and external stakeholders addressing inquiries and ensuring effective communication.
  • Conducts research and compiles data for projects presentations or reports as needed.
  • Supports special projects and initiatives by managing timelines coordinating tasks and providing administrative support.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Maintains regular and reliable attendance.
  • Complies with all policies and standards.
